Activity During WWII

He proudly served his country in the U.S. Marine Corps at 18 years old in 1942 during WWII. He spent 30 months in the Pacific Theater of Operations and served as a platoon Sergeant. He landed on Okinawa with the third wave shortly after Easter, April 1, 1945. He experienced the worst fighting in the final three weeks on Okinawa. He received BATTLE STARS FOR ROI-NAMUR, MARSHALL ISLAND AND OKINAWA.
